Police say they’ve apprehended a man who was sought after in a string of robberies, including this smash-and-grab incident in the Bronx. The NYPD says in this incident, he smashed the front window of a jewelry store, then reached in and started grabbing the merchandise on display. Meanwhile another man held a bag that the first man kept stuffing with his loot. The store was open at the time and someone inside tried to lower the mechanical gate.
